Focusrite Scarlett 2i2

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 Audio Interface

The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 is a beloved audio interface in the home studio community. It has garnered a reputation for its high-quality preamps and budget-friendly price tag.

Key Features:

  • High-Quality Preamps: The Scarlett 2i2 boasts two of Focusrite’s signature preamps, which are known for their transparent sound and low noise.
  • 24-bit/192kHz Recording: This interface supports high-resolution audio, ensuring you capture every nuance of your recordings.
  • USB-C Connectivity: It’s equipped with a USB-C connection, making it compatible with both Mac and PC.
  • Software Bundle: The Scarlett 2i2 comes with a comprehensive software package, including Pro Tools First, Ableton Live Lite, and more.
  • Air Mode: The Air mode adds an extra touch of brightness to your recordings, enhancing vocal and acoustic instrument tracks.

Audio Quality:

The Scarlett 2i2 delivers impressive audio quality, especially considering its price point. The preamps are the standout feature, offering clean, detailed sound with minimal distortion.

Connectivity:

  • 2 XLR/TRS combo inputs
  • 2 Line outputs
  • Headphone output

Software Integration:

It comes with a range of useful software, making it an excellent choice for beginners looking to get started right away.

Price:

The Scarlett 2i2 is known for its affordability, making it an excellent choice for those on a budget.

Universal Audio Apollo Twin MkII

Universal Audio Apollo Twin MkII Audio Interface

Universal Audio is renowned for its professional-grade audio interfaces, and the Apollo Twin MkII is no exception. It’s a favorite among serious musicians and producers.

Key Features:

  • Unison Preamps: The Apollo Twin MkII features Unison preamps, emulating classic analog gear to achieve vintage, warm tones.
  • Real-time UAD Processing: This interface leverages UAD plug-ins in real time, reducing the load on your computer’s CPU.
  • Thunderbolt Connectivity: With Thunderbolt, it offers lightning-fast data transfer for Mac users.
  • Console 2.0 Software: The Console 2.0 software provides extensive control over your recording and mixing process.
  • Integration with UAD Plug-ins: Access to Universal Audio’s extensive library of plug-ins, providing professional-grade processing tools.

Audio Quality:

The Apollo Twin MkII excels in audio quality, especially if you’re seeking that classic analog sound. The Unison preamps are a standout feature.

Connectivity:

  • 2 XLR/TRS combo inputs
  • 2 Line outputs
  • ADAT input
  • Thunderbolt port
  • Headphone output

Software Integration:

The integration with UAD plug-ins is a game-changer for professionals looking to add top-quality processing to their recordings.

Price:

The Apollo Twin MkII is a premium option and comes at a higher price point, catering to serious musicians and producers.

PreSonus AudioBox USB

PreSonus AudioBox USB Audio Interface

PreSonus is known for producing high-quality audio equipment at an accessible price point, and the AudioBox USB is a prime example of this.

Key Features:

  • 2 XMAX Preamps: The AudioBox USB features XMAX preamps, known for their clean and transparent sound.
  • MIDI I/O: It offers MIDI input and output, making it ideal for musicians working with MIDI controllers and synthesizers.
  • Compact and Portable: This interface is lightweight and portable, perfect for musicians on the move.
  • Studio One Artist Software: It comes with PreSonus’ Studio One Artist software for recording, editing, and mixing.
  • Budget-Friendly: The AudioBox USB is an excellent option for those on a tight budget.

Audio Quality:

The XMAX preamps deliver clean, high-quality sound, making this interface a great choice for beginners and budget-conscious users.

Connectivity:

  • 2 XLR/TRS combo inputs
  • MIDI I/O
  • 2 Line outputs
  • Headphone output

Software Integration:

The inclusion of Studio One Artist provides users with a comprehensive recording and mixing solution.

Price:

The AudioBox USB is one of the most affordable options, making it a practical choice for entry-level users.

MOTU M2

MOTU M2 Audio Interface

The MOTU M2 is a compact and highly capable audio interface, ideal for musicians and producers looking for portability without sacrificing audio quality.

Key Features:

  • ESS Sabre32 DAC Technology: This interface is known for its pristine audio quality, thanks to ESS Sabre32 DAC technology.
  • Loopback Feature: The M2 offers loopback functionality, making it suitable for podcasters and streamers.
  • USB-C Connectivity: With a USB-C connection, it’s compatible with both Mac and PC.
  • On-board Metering: It features on-board meters for precise monitoring of your input levels.
  • Bus-Powered: The M2 is bus-powered, making it a perfect choice for mobile recording setups.

Audio Quality:

The ESS Sabre32 DAC technology ensures top-tier audio quality, making the M2 suitable for demanding recording and mixing tasks.

Connectivity:

  • 2 XLR/TRS combo inputs
  • 2 Line outputs
  • Headphone output
  • USB-C connectivity

Software Integration:

It includes a range of useful software, making it a practical choice for musicians and content creators.

Price:

The MOTU M2 is competitively priced, offering excellent value for its audio quality and features.

Audient iD4

Audient iD4 Audio Interface

The Audient iD4 is a compact and stylish audio interface known for its exceptional preamps and overall sound quality.

Key Features:

  • Class-A Audient Console Mic Preamplifier: The iD4’s preamp is known for its warm and rich sound, suitable for both vocals and instruments.
  • High-Performance AD/DA Converters: It boasts high-performance analog-to-digital and digital-to-analog converters, ensuring excellent sound quality.
  • JFET Instrument Input: The JFET instrument input is perfect for capturing the unique character of your guitar or bass.
  • ScrollControl: The ScrollControl feature provides hands-on control over your DAW and software settings.
  • Stylish and Durable: The iD4 features a sleek and robust design.

Audio Quality:

The Audient iD4 shines in audio quality, offering a warm and detailed sound, particularly through its preamp.

Connectivity:

  • 1 XLR/TRS combo input
  • 1 Line output
  • JFET instrument input
  • Headphone output

Software Integration:

The iD4 includes a comprehensive software package, making it an excellent choice for those starting their studio journey.

Price:

While it’s not the most budget-friendly option, the iD4 offers exceptional value for its audio quality.

Conclusion

Each of these audio interfaces has its own unique strengths and caters to different needs and preferences. The Focusrite Scarlett 2i2 is an excellent choice for those on a budget seeking quality preamps. The Universal Audio Apollo Twin MkII caters to professionals looking for top-tier sound and real-time UAD processing. The PreSonus AudioBox USB is a budget-friendly option for beginners. The MOTU M2 is perfect for mobile setups and demanding recording tasks. The Audient iD4 shines with its exceptional preamp and audio quality.

When choosing the best audio interface for your home digital recording studio, consider your specific needs, budget, and the kind of sound quality you desire.
